Viral 'Indian Massage' Video Featuring Alcohol Prompts Jakarta Government to Urge Creator Caution

The DKI Jakarta Provincial Government has urged content creators to be wiser in making and disseminating content on social media. The appeal came after a video went viral narrating the practice of ‘Indian-style massage’ accompanied by the serving of alcoholic beverages in the Danau Sunter area, North Jakarta. Special Staff to the Governor of DKI Jakarta, Chico Hakim, said the provincial government appreciates the concern of residents and traders who reported the issue. His party will continue to maintain order and comfort in public spaces. “We appreciate the concern of local residents and traders who felt disturbed. The DKI Jakarta Provincial Government consistently maintains order and comfort in public spaces, including recreational areas such as Danau Sunter,” Chico told reporters on Sunday (19/7/2026). He stated that the sale and serving of alcoholic beverages in public spaces is strictly regulated. He confirmed that supervision and enforcement against violators will continue. “The sale and serving of alcoholic beverages in public spaces is strictly regulated according to applicable regulations, and we continue to conduct supervision and take action against violations,” he said. Chico also urged content creators and the public to be wiser in using social media. He asked the public to avoid content that could cause unrest. “Our appeal to all content creators and the public is to use social media wisely, responsibly, and positively. Avoid content that can cause public unrest or a negative impression of the Jakarta area,” he said. “Let us work together to maintain Jakarta’s image as a safe, comfortable, and family-friendly city. We invite all parties to contribute to building educational and entertaining narratives without disturbing public order,” he added. Previously, the Tanjung Priok District Public Order Agency (Satpol PP) confirmed that the viral video narrating the practice of ‘Indian-style massage’ accompanied by the serving of alcoholic beverages in the Danau Sunter area, North Jakarta, did not match the conditions on the ground. Officers stated that the information circulating on social media was merely content. This confirmation was delivered after Tanjung Priok District Satpol PP, together with the North Jakarta City Administration Satpol PP, conducted a direct inspection of the location on Friday (18/7). “Officers conducted checks and clarifications with traders, residents, and community leaders around the location. Based on the results of the field examination, no massage service activities or serving of alcoholic beverages were found as reported,” wrote Tanjung Priok District Satpol PP via its official Instagram account on Saturday (18/7). Satpol PP emphasised that the information circulating on social media did not match the actual conditions at Danau Sunter. “The circulating information is known to be merely social media content and does not correspond to the actual conditions at the location,” it stated.
